Positive bird flu case reported on county farm

A Worcester County chicken farm has preliminarily tested positive for bird flu, the county’s first reported case of the disease. State officials quarantined the affected premises, which has not been named, and all birds on the property are being culled to prevent the spread of Highly Pathogenic H5 Avian Influenza, according to a news release …

5-night minimum rental stay passes for residential areas

City officials are moving forward with an ordinance that sets a minimum length of stay for short-term rentals located in single-family and mobile home communities. During Monday’s meeting, the Ocean City Council voted to approve the first reading of an ordinance that will establish a five-night minimum length of stay for short-term rentals in the …
